    The recovery time for Forma treatment in Melbourne typically ranges from a few hours to a couple of days, depending on individual factors such as skin sensitivity and the extent of treatment. Forma, a non-invasive skin tightening and rejuvenation procedure, uses radiofrequency energy to stimulate collagen production, resulting in smoother, more youthful-looking skin.

    Immediately after the treatment, patients may experience mild redness and warmth, which usually subsides within a few hours. Some individuals might also notice slight swelling or tenderness, but these effects are temporary and typically resolve within 24 to 48 hours. It's important to follow post-treatment care instructions provided by your practitioner to ensure optimal recovery and results.

    Most patients can resume their normal activities shortly after the procedure, although avoiding direct sun exposure and using sunscreen is recommended to protect the newly treated skin. Over the next few weeks, you'll start to see gradual improvements in skin texture and firmness as collagen production continues.

    Overall, Forma offers a relatively quick recovery period, making it a convenient option for those seeking to enhance their skin's appearance without significant downtime.

    Understanding the Recovery Process for Forma in Melbourne

    The Forma treatment, available in Melbourne, is renowned for its ability to rejuvenate the skin through non-invasive radio-frequency technology. One of the most frequently asked questions by prospective patients is about the recovery time associated with this procedure. Understanding what to expect post-treatment can help you plan your schedule and manage your expectations effectively.

    Immediate Post-Procedure Symptoms

    Immediately following the Forma treatment, patients may experience some common symptoms such as redness and warmth in the treated area. These sensations are normal and are indicative of the skin's response to the thermal energy delivered during the procedure. The redness typically subsides within a few hours, while the warmth may persist for a bit longer, usually within the first 24 hours.

    Short Recovery Period

    The recovery time for Forma in Melbourne is quite manageable, often ranging from just a few hours to a couple of days. This relatively short recovery period is one of the key advantages of Forma, making it a popular choice for those with busy lifestyles who still wish to maintain a youthful appearance. During this period, it is advisable to avoid direct sun exposure and to use gentle skincare products to ensure the skin heals optimally.

    Optimal Healing Tips

    To ensure a smooth and speedy recovery, follow these tips: 1. Hydrate: Drink plenty of water to keep your skin hydrated and promote healing. 2. Gentle Skincare: Use mild, fragrance-free skincare products to avoid irritation. 3. Sun Protection: Apply a broad-spectrum sunscreen with at least SPF 30 to protect the treated skin from UV damage. 4. Avoid Aggressive Treatments: Refrain from using harsh exfoliants or undergoing other intense skincare treatments for at least a week post-procedure.

    Long-Term Benefits

    While the immediate recovery period is brief, the long-term benefits of Forma are significant. Patients often notice improvements in skin texture, tone, and elasticity over the weeks following the treatment. These benefits are a result of the deep collagen remodeling that occurs as the skin heals and regenerates.

    In conclusion, the Forma treatment in Melbourne offers a quick and manageable recovery period, making it an excellent option for those looking to enhance their skin's appearance without a lengthy downtime. By following the recommended post-treatment care, you can ensure the best possible outcome and enjoy the lasting benefits of this innovative procedure.

    Understanding the Recovery Process for Forma in Melbourne

    When considering any cosmetic procedure, understanding the recovery time is crucial. Forma, a popular skin tightening treatment, offers significant benefits with minimal downtime. Here’s a detailed look at what you can expect during your recovery period in Melbourne.

    Immediate Post-Procedure Experience

    Immediately after your Forma treatment, you may notice some redness and mild swelling, similar to a sunburn. This is a normal reaction and typically subsides within a few hours. Applying a cold compress can help alleviate any discomfort and reduce swelling. It’s important to keep the treated area clean and avoid any harsh skincare products for the first 24 hours.

    Day-to-Day Recovery

    Over the next few days, you should avoid direct sun exposure and use a high-SPF sunscreen if you need to be outdoors. Mild peeling or flaking of the skin may occur, which is a sign that the treatment is working. Keeping your skin hydrated with a gentle moisturizer will help manage this. It’s also advisable to avoid strenuous activities and hot baths or saunas to prevent any unnecessary irritation.

    Week-Long Recovery

    By the end of the first week, most patients report feeling back to their normal routines. The redness and swelling should have completely subsided, and any mild peeling should be minimal. At this stage, you can gradually reintroduce your regular skincare regimen, but continue to be gentle with your skin. Regular follow-up appointments with your practitioner are recommended to monitor your progress and ensure optimal results.

    Long-Term Care and Maintenance

    While the immediate recovery period is relatively short, maintaining the results of Forma requires ongoing care. This includes a consistent skincare routine with products that support collagen production and skin elasticity. Regular touch-up sessions can also help prolong the effects of the treatment.

    In summary, the recovery time for Forma in Melbourne is generally quick and manageable, allowing you to return to your daily activities within a week. By following the post-procedure care instructions and maintaining a healthy skincare routine, you can enjoy the lasting benefits of this innovative skin tightening treatment.
